Subject: Revert "net: netprio_cgroup: make net_prio_subsys static"

This reverts commit 865d9f9f748fdc1943679ea65d9ee1dc55e4a6ae.

This commit breaks the build with CONFIG_NETPRIO_CGROUP=y so
revert it. It does build as a module though. The SUBSYS macro
in the cgroup core code automatically defines a subsys structure
as extern. Long term we should fix the macro. And I need to
fully build test things.

Tested with CONFIG_NETPRIO_CGROUP={y|m|n} with and without
CONFIG_CGROUPS defined.
